Based in Houston, Rob Andrews is Chief Executive Officer & Chairman of Gaines International│Allen Austin. Rob leads Allen Austin’s global CEO, Consumer Packaged Goods & Durables Practice, and is also a member of the firm’s Leadership Advisory, Private Equity, Industrial and Marketing Officer practices. Building on his earlier career experience as an operating president with major convenience store and supermarket chains, Rob conducts searches for board members, CEO and senior officers across a broad range of sectors. He also helped design and helps deliver Allen Austin’s premier Leadership Institute, Organizational Review, Leadership Communications Dynamics, Culture Shaping and Extraordinary Service Leadership Program.

Rob’s clients have run the gamut from $6 million privately held enterprises to $75+ billion publicly held multinational corporations, and include companies such as Safeway, 7-11, Maverik Markets, Sonic, Kroger, Sysco, PepsiCo, Kraft, Kmart, Tyson, Nestle, Lindsay Goldberg, Littlejohn and many more.

Prior to launching Allen Austin, Rob’s consulting experience included assignments as President of a national healthcare search firm, and EVP of two boutique generalist search firms. His experience includes senior operating, marketing and administrative assignments with Kash n’ Karry Food Stores and National Convenience Stores with total P&L responsibility for enterprises with store count up to 516, revenues of up to $2.4 billion and headcount of 10,600. He also led major culture change, service excellence initiatives and major research in choreographing the customer’s shopping experience and extraordinary service excellence.

Rob completed an undergraduate degree in marketing and economics at Our Lady of the Lake University in San Antonio, Texas, while managing the southwestern division for NCS in 1991, his graduate work in business at the University of Texas at Austin in 1996, and Leading Professional Service Firms Program at the Harvard Business School in 2007.
